What is cameras and musical instruments

The Cameras and Musical Instruments Application is a business insurance application used by individuals or businesses to obtain insurance coverage for photography equipment and musical instruments.

Key Features of the Cameras and Musical Instruments Application

This application includes several fillable fields designed to gather crucial information. Users must provide their name, contact information, and descriptions of the equipment they wish to insure.
  • Applicant’s Name
  • Applicant’s Phone Number
  • Social Security Number
  • Signature lines for both the applicant and producer
  • Sections detailing business operations and prior insurance history
These features ensure that all pertinent details are collected, which is essential for processing the insurance application effectively.
